This artwork is a whimsical and striking illustration of a silverback gorilla dressed as a ballerina, blending raw power with delicate elegance. The gorilla, rendered in fine black ink lines, wears a detailed pink tutu and leotard, posed mid-dance with arms extended gracefully like a seasoned ballet performer.
The background is filled with a collage of stamped words in varying fonts and shades—“BIPEDAL,” “LOVE,” “TUTU,” “DANCE,” “SILVERBACK,” “BALLET,” “APE,” “JUNGLE,” and “WILDLIFE”—repeating across a soft pink backdrop. These words add texture and thematic contrast, emphasizing the blend of wild nature and refined art.
